The CF's are impressive all-around speakers performing well on all material I've used. The high's and vocal ranges sound very good and detailed. The lower frequencies are tight and extended. In fact the bass response is so good on the CF's that if I didn't already own a subwoofer I probably wouldn't feel the need to have one.

Speaker cables are stranded copper 14 guage with Sewell banana connectors. Cons: I also own pricey audiophile gear and have speaker cables thast cost more than a pair of the CF's on sale at Newegg. My overall impression is that the CF's are not just very impressive all-around speakers, they are probably one of the best values in home audio at the sale price. The main difference is broad polar pattern, which allows forming a three-dimensional picture, also falling back to first reflections from walls, floor and ceiling.

You feel it immediately - the scene is extensive, deep and sound sources are focused even at very far distances. In whole the sound differs by high intelligibility, there is no "mess" or veil in difficult phonograms that in combination with high dynamics makes a strong impression. Bass is tight; control is slightly lost in the lowest area, where some monotony appears. Double-bass is played energetically and effectively, its tone has lots of nuances. It sparkles and thumps, and gives you enough through the middle to slide by in critical listening sessions, but it will not remind you of a British monitor.

But, at its very affordable price, it brings a lot of value, is pretty efficient, and can fill a large room with a lot of crisp sound.

None of its flaws stick out in the least in drawing you away from the sound. For anyone looking for a budget big speaker, the CF should definitely be on your audition list.
